NA discusses revising 1992 Constitution

(VOVworld) – The National Assembly deputies have discussed revision to the 1992 Constitution and a draft resolution on the amendment public consultation.

The revisions amend 9 articles clarify the status, role, and leadership of the Party, strengthen protections and respect for human rights, and create a constitutional foundation for international cooperation, defining national rights and responsibilities. Tran Minh Dieu, a deputy from Quang Binh province, says " The government’s power belongs to the people. This is an important concept. The Party’s platform and resolution make this a guiding principle of the revision process.  The people exercise their power through the National Assembly and the People’s Councils, which are elected by the people to represent their will and aspirations and remain responsible to the people."

The revisions include amendments on human rights and fundamental civil rights and duties, and reinforces the power of the President to command the people’s armed forces and to be the President of the National Defense and Security Council.

The revision will be made public to collect opinions from January 2nd to March 31st. The Committee on revising the Constitution will summarize deputy and voter opinions and will submit a revised constitution to the NA for approval at the 6th session next year.
